Panduit PWBPF4X24BL - The Formed Tee Fitting provides the needed coverage for a 90 degree turn. The formed tee comes complete with a base liner,two brackets and two side liners in order to protect cables from any sharp edges. The tee fitting also comes with two mounting hole locations to be used with threaded rod. This formed tee is intended for a 4" wide basket with a 24" side wall.

Frequently Asked Questions

What types of cables can the Wire Basket system manage?

The system is designed to route and manage copper, fiber optic, or power cables.

What are the available dimensions for the wire baskets?

Pathway sections come in widths from 4 inches to 36 inches. Baskets are 118.33 inches long with 2, 4, or 6 inch sidewall heights.

What safety and compliance approvals does the system have?

The system is UL Listed for use as an Equipment Grounding Conductor per NFPA 70 and NEMA VE1. Black and White finishes comply with ASTM 510.

Where is the Wire Basket system typically used?

It is used in data centers, connected buildings, and industrial environments to route and protect various cables. Its open design aids cooling and maintenance in high-density setups.

What finishes are available for the wire basket components?

Baskets, accessories, and components are available in black, electro zinc, pre-galvanized, or white finishes.

How does the grid pattern benefit cable installation?

The larger wire mesh grid pattern provides greater bottom cable exit capacity, allowing more cables to pass through without additional cuts, reducing installation time.

What is the T-Welded Safety Edge feature?

The T-Welded Safety Edge meets industry safety specifications, promoting installer safety and providing simultaneous cable protection.

How is bonding simplified in the system?

Prepared masked pathway sections simplify bonding at splice connections, making the process easier.

What types of mounting brackets are available?

Available mounting options include trapeze, cantilever, vertical wall mount, sidewall mount, and raised floor pedestal support brackets.

What types of splice connections are available?

The system offers bolted style, push-on style, and expansion splice bar connections for pathway sections.

How to Install the PANDUIT Wire Basket

This guide provides step-by-step instructions for installing the PANDUIT Wire Basket with TEE-Intersection Brackets.

Estimated time: 45m

Tools needed:

Screwdriver, Wrench

Supplies needed:

Mounting hardware, Threaded rods, Push-in fasteners, Cable ties

  1. Assemble radius support brackets

    Attach one radius support bracket to each side of the wire basket using the supplied fasteners, keeping them loose for adjustment.

  2. Hang the wire basket

    Securely hang the wire basket using customer-supplied threaded rods, ensuring that all trapeze brackets are within 2 feet from the intersection.

  3. Install the connection plate

    Add the connection plate to cover the gap between the baskets and loosely attach it with the supplied fasteners.

  4. Tighten all fasteners

    Once all components are in place, tighten all fasteners to secure the installation.

  5. Attach protective sheets

    Place the protective sheets along the radius of the corner and attach them using push-in fasteners and cable ties if desired.
